BLESSED BEYOND CURSE (PART 10I) EMPOWERED TO BE FRUITFUL – NO MORE BARRENNESS

It is not every woe in your life that the enemy is responsible for, some are your own doing and until you accept that, God will consider you a hypocrite. If you don’t accept responsibility for your actions, you will find it difficult to even repent. In my walk with God in the deliverance ministry of close to thirty years, I can tell you authoritatively that man is man’s own greatest enemy. When man decides to yield his will to the snake, what do you expect? Look at Adam? Why should Adam fall?

A perfect man in a perfect environment with only one command and when he fell he told God ‘it is the woman you gave me’. There was no repentance, no remorse. What he was saying in essence is if God did not give him the woman, he would not have fallen. Everybody is looking for whom to blame. Meanwhile everyone has twenty-four hours a day. How are you spending yours? Are you sowing emptiness and expecting fruits? God said, be not deceived. There are many dimensions of deception but the worst is self-deception which is the lie you tell yourself. This is the greatest deception there is.

Anyone who tells himself a lie cannot truly repent. Is there any way you are tolerating it in your heart? What are you sowing? How are you sowing the time that God has allotted to you here on earth? Can you beat your chest and say that you are truly productive? How can you produce nothing and expect supernatural abundance? Another dimension of deception is the deception of another man. That is why you must not keep bad association if you want to prosper. Psa. 1:1-3 says, “Blessed is the man that walketh not in the counsel of the ungodly, nor standeth in the way of sinners, nor sitteth in the seat of the scornful. But his delight is in the law of the LORD, and in his law doth he meditate day and night. And she shall be like a tree planted by the rivers of water, that bringeth forth his fruit in his season; his leaf also shall not wither; and whatsoever he doeth shall prosper.”

There is a close relationship between your association and fruit bearing. God wants us to get to the dimension of “whatsoever he doeth shall prosper”. Reaping is a natural consequence of sowing; if you sow nothing, you will reap nothing. As a student, don’t expect to reap excellence while sowing in computer games. What are you sowing? Are you a consumer or a producer? How have you invested your last twenty-four hours? Analyze it.

How have you been sowing in the past? Are you sowing in the flesh or in the spirit? Remember that the seed is always smaller than the harvest. God had a Son but he wanted a family; he wanted a kingdom of priests and kings, he had to sow his Son. The Bible says, “except a corn of wheat fall into the ground and die, it abideth alone: but if it die, it bringeth forth much fruit.” John 12:24.
